what do u mean "it does pull timing" what is pull timing???
Re: Check engine light
Monday, April 03, 2006 8:38 AM
It change the timing, when you have a CEL, your car won't be as performant as normal. It's there to avoid other damages. It pull the timing back.





Re: Check engine light
Monday, April 03, 2006 8:51 AM
it will only pull timing if it is required by the CEL code


so no its not always true


get the code scaned so you know what you are dealing with , and people will be able to give you a direction on how to correct it
